I have found that a main culprit of a poor DataContainer performance for
large caches (100K entries +) is in fact use of default concurrency of
32.
Does that cause BCHM to create only 32 segments, that resulting in lots of
contention on concurrent updates?
If users are going to use caches with many entries then they should
also increase concurrency level. I found that concurrency of 512 works
fairly well for caches up to million entries. Also note that if users
are using such large caches (1M+ entries) I do not see the point of
having eviction, they should just use unbounded DataContainer.
I'm not sure
this is true for all use cases: e.g. 1M Integers occupy cca 4Mb, and people might want to
allocated up to Gb to cache data.
What I think we can do is suggest them(log), based on the DC size, to increase the
concurrencyLevel when needed.
